Opinion: Baltic states cannot be sovereign in EU, NATO

MINSK, 10 May (BelTA) – The Baltic states cannot be sovereign being members of the European Union and NATO, the head of the Baltnews news agency, political scientist Andrei Starikov said on the air of the Belarus 1 TV channel, BelTA informs.

Latvia has recently marked the 32nd anniversary of the restoration of independence. “When we talk about the state, it is correct to talk about sovereignty. But it does not exist. Can they determine their own foreign policy? They cannot. Can they fully determine their own domestic and personnel policy? They cannot, either. As to Latvia, it is a well-known fact that the composition of the Cabinet of Ministers, the list of ministers is forwarded to the U.S. Embassy in Riga for approval,” Andrei Starikov said.

According to him, the Baltic countries are not economically self-sufficient. “These are bodies connected to artificial life-support devices in the form of European foundations and subsidies. They cannot be sovereign being in the EU and NATO. These organizations are not collegial bodies. Countries are not equal there, which is not the case with our formations, like the Eurasian Economic Union, the CSTO. We took into account all the shortcomings of similar Western structures, so we created our organizations in a completely different way,” the political scientist stated.
